Public Sector
The part of the economy comprising government services and publicly operated enterprises, funded by taxation.
Communist Credo
A set of ideological beliefs central to communism, advocating for a classless society in which the means of production are owned and controlled communally.
The Soviet Union
A former federal socialist state in northern Eurasia that existed from 1922 to 1991, officially known as the Union of Soviet Socialist Republics (USSR).
China's Economic Growth
A phenomenon marked by rapid industrialization, significant increases in GDP, and lifting millions out of poverty, transforming the country into a major global economy.
